Sumario:In this paper, leak detection and localization in water distribution networks will be reviewed. In particular, the paper presents the evolution of the methods from model-based towards data-based approaches, listing, describing and comparing the main and/or most recent methods of both categories. Besides, the practical applicability in real water utilities of different existing methods is discussed, outlining the advantages and limitations of model-based and data-driven methods for this task. A well-known case study is used to compare some of the more promising methods and illustrate their performances. Perspectives of the future evolution of the current existing methods are also provided.
